What is PPSkit?
Description:    General kernel patch to implement nanoseconds as time
                resolution.  Upgrades the kernel clock model for NTP v4
                (nanokernel '#3'), including PPS support.  Adds support for
                capturing external timestamps with high precision via RFC 2783
                (PPS API v1).

Status of PPSkit

The  following  table  summarizes  the  current  status of PPSkit. For each
architecture the questions Compiles?/Works OK? are answered. Possible
choices are Y for Yes (non-SMP), S for Yes (even SMP), and N for No.

For Status the possible choices are Y for Yes (current branch), C for
Conditionally (if you can convince me), and N for No (sources probably
unavailable).
Last releases of PPSkit on each branch, the corresponding Linux kernel   release
, maintenance status, and the compilation/execution status.             Usually 
only the top branch is actively maintained.
